Operations suspended at the Sawani Border for 24-hours to allow for decontamination

No activities will be conducted at the Sawani Border in Naitasiri today as it will be closed for decontamination and upgrade works.

In a statement, the government says the border will be closed for a period of 24-hours, beginning at 4am today and ending at 4am tomorrow with all activities conducted at the border suspended during this period.

Only emergency medical referrals will be allowed through the border.

For urgent essential services, people are to use the Qiolevu Road in Sawani to gain access to the Navuso Shopping Centre.

The government says the resumption of operations at the Sawani Border will be announced accordingly.
